MGRS Decoded

MGRS encodes location as a nested hierarchy — zone, band, grid square, and offsets. Here is what each component of 53MPU2327468442 means.

Component Value Meaning
UTM Zone 53 One of 60 vertical slices of Earth (6° wide each). Zone 53 runs 132° to 138° longitude.
Latitude Band M One of 20 horizontal bands (8° tall each), lettered C–X (skipping I and O). Indicates the general latitude region.
100 km Square PU A 100 × 100 km grid square within the zone/band. Column letter P (west–east) and row letter U (south–north).
Easting 23274 Distance east within the 100 km square. 5-digit value = 10 m resolution. Multiply by 1 to get meters.
Northing 68442 Distance north within the 100 km square. Same resolution as easting (10 m).

Geohash Precision

A geohash encodes coordinates by subdividing the Earth into progressively smaller cells. Each extra character roughly halves the cell area. The table below shows Frans Kaisiepo Airport's geohash at every precision level alongside the bounding box each level represents.
